java String字符串每两位添加一个空格

前言

CSDN博客地址
GitHub https://github.com/MrQ-Android

最近遇到一个需求,java的字符串每隔两位添加一个空格

具体的解决方案:
1.常规做法 for循环遍历添加
2.优雅的方式 , 使用正则表达式完成

1.常规for循环应该就不用解释了,就是遍历一下两位添加一下就ok

2.第二种方式是比较好的 使用正则

public static String getFileAddSpace(String replace) {
    String regex = "(.{2})";
    replace = replace.replaceAll(regex, "$1 ");
    return replace;
}

希望这篇文章可以帮助到需要的人,如果还有其他问题或者补充可以评论~~~
如果有帮助记得点赞哦!

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• Android 自定义View的各种姿势1 Activity的显示之ViewRootImpl详解 Activity...
    passiontim阅读 173,663评论 25 708
  • 我,一个一无所有的普通高中生。秃废过,努力过,却在不知不觉中有了一丝明悟。想在这里和大家分享一下。 小学,少不更事...
    谭氏阅读 257评论 0 0
  • 欢欢乐乐的一个晚上就这样的过去了,此刻,深夜的寂静弥漫在新年伊始的充满期待与幻想的夜空中。你们在炸炮竹,我在朋友圈...
    我係凡大头阅读 247评论 2 3
  • 如果,寻找是可能的话,人的一生,无非寻找两样东西——眼睛看的,耳朵听的。人世光怪陆离、众生百态,自有看客评说。声音...
    花儿梦工场阅读 400评论 0 0
  • 真伪鉴别 由于高铁酸钾的价格较PP粉(高锰酸钾)高,而颜色不注意分辩的话又好像差不多。因此,市场上就出现了各种以P...
    垦春泥阅读 6,688评论 0 1